Transaction 502577a33bb6c0f1140d9177ebc78fa2f89137ccdf87564943106324b96a808c

1 Input
2 Outputs
  • 502577a33bb6c0f1140d9177ebc78fa2f89137ccdf87564943106324b96a808c:0
  • value  1672889
    address  1HR1DkwJKfksMHKiQpZjnseCN2q3tEQ9aw
  • 502577a33bb6c0f1140d9177ebc78fa2f89137ccdf87564943106324b96a808c:1
  • value  688051993
    address  36WsoBH2AUx7R2aeyxhtWepPiLKqESz9Vd